Introduction to the engine control unit (ecu)
The Engine Control Unit (ECU), also known as the Engine Control Module (ECM), is one of the most crucial components in modern vehicles. It serves as the brain of the engine management system, controlling a wide array of functions ranging from fuel injection to ignition timing, emission control, and even engine temperature regulation. When the ECU fails, it can cause a cascade of issues that affect the vehicle’s performance, efficiency, and even safety. Modern vehicles rely heavily on the ECU to operate efficiently and meet emissions standards. However, like any complex electronic component, the ECU is vulnerable to a variety of issues that can lead to its failure. Understanding the common causes of ECU failure is key to diagnosing and addressing these problems before they lead to costly repairs or more severe engine issues.
Electrical overload or voltage spikes
One of the most frequent causes of ECU failure in modern vehicles is electrical overload or voltage spikes. The ECU is sensitive to fluctuations in electrical voltage, which can occur for various reasons, including: – Improper jump-starting: Incorrectly jump-starting a car can cause power surges that damage the ECU. – Faulty alternator: A malfunctioning alternator can lead to overcharging, sending high voltage to the ECU. – Loose or corroded battery terminals: A poor connection can result in unstable voltage reaching the ECU. These electrical irregularities can fry the ECU’s delicate circuits, leading to a complete failure of the unit. In some cases, electrical issues can even damage the wiring harness that connects the ECU to the rest of the vehicle’s systems.
Water or moisture damage
Water ingress is another common cause of ECU failure. Modern ECUs are typically located in areas of the vehicle that are exposed to the elements, such as near the engine or under the dashboard. If these areas are not properly sealed, water can infiltrate the ECU housing, causing: – Corrosion of internal components – Short circuits – Malfunctioning of sensors and actuators Rain, washing the vehicle, or even driving through flooded areas can lead to moisture buildup in the ECU. Once moisture penetrates the ECU’s casing, it can lead to permanent damage that requires replacement of the entire unit. Regular maintenance, such as checking for seals and ensuring that the ECU is properly shielded, can help mitigate the risk of water damage.
Overheating
Overheating is another significant factor that can contribute to ECU failure. The ECU generates its own heat while operating, and in most vehicles, it is designed to withstand temperatures within a certain range. However, extreme conditions—such as high engine temperatures, inadequate cooling, or poor airflow around the ECU—can cause the unit to overheat. High temperatures can lead to: – Damage to the ECU’s internal components, such as capacitors and transistors – Degraded solder joints, which can break under heat stress – Electronic component failure An overheating ECU will often exhibit signs such as erratic engine behavior, failure to start, or even complete engine shutdowns. If the vehicle’s cooling system is not functioning correctly, it can result in both engine and ECU failures.
Faulty sensors or wiring issues
The ECU relies on input from a variety of sensors to manage engine performance. These sensors monitor parameters such as temperature, air-fuel ratio, and exhaust emissions. If any of these sensors fail or if there is damage to the wiring that connects the ECU to these sensors, it can result in incorrect data being sent to the ECU. This can cause the ECU to make incorrect decisions, leading to: – Engine misfires – Poor fuel efficiency – Increased emissions Additionally, damaged wiring or poor connections can lead to intermittent or complete ECU failure. Diagnosing faulty sensors or wiring can sometimes be difficult, as the symptoms may seem like a problem with the ECU itself. However, proper diagnostic equipment can help identify which part of the system is causing the failure.
Software corruption or glitches
Modern ECUs rely on software programming to control various engine functions. Sometimes, the software may become corrupted due to glitches, faulty updates, or incompatibility with other components in the vehicle. Software corruption can occur for a variety of reasons: – Failed firmware updates – Software bugs introduced by the manufacturer – Incompatibility between ECU software and other control modules When software corruption occurs, the ECU may fail to perform basic functions correctly, leading to erratic engine behavior, the illumination of warning lights on the dashboard, or even complete engine shutdown. In some cases, a simple software reset or reprogramming may be enough to fix the issue, but in severe cases, replacing the ECU may be necessary. Continue reading